Things To Consider While Buying Gold Filled Beads

Gold filled beads have achieved a great success in the jewelry industry. These beads are probably the best products of the gold filled jewelry. They are used in a great number of ornaments to give them a highly traditional and beautiful appearance. Mostly used as spacers, the jewelry made from these gold-filled beads is very popular among youngsters. These beads offer a wide variety of styles and designs to choose from.

Easy maintenance of these beads makes them apt for daily use. The gold filled beads are made of no less than 10 karats of gold. Thus, it makes a thick layer of gold, which increases the life of the beads despite regular use.

As these beads are mostly used by fashion jewelry designers, these are often sold by wholesale dealers. This is indeed a much more beneficial option to buy beads from a wholesale seller than to buy them from a jewelry store. Many wholesale dealers sell gold plated beads instead of gold filled ones. Gold plated beads can be made to look the same at a much cheaper cost. Thus, the profit of the seller increases with every sale. It is a bit difficult to spot the difference between the two types of beads. One has to be attentive enough to look for some indications.

Gold plated beads mostly use silver, brass or copper as their base metals. The metals are coated with gold, which gives the same shine and color as that of gold filled beads. However, at first, you must check for the signs of chipping. Gold plated beads would easily chip while gold filled beads would never peel off even after prolonged usage. Second clue to notice is that a person who has a sensitive skin might develop allergic reactions by wearing gold plated jewelry. This would again prove that the beads being sold are not filled with gold but are instead coated. Thirdly, authentic gold filled beads would always display a stamp indicating the weight and the amount of gold used in the product. Two of the most commonly found stamps would say 10/20 and 14/20 that represent 10K and 14k gold filled beads respectively. Keeping the above points in mind would save a person from getting cheated while buying wholesale beads.
